Document Description
Replace all twenty-two (22) window sashes at the Sugar Pine Caretaker's House in Ed Z'berg Sugar Pine Point State Park to protect this cultural resource and allow continued use of the building as an employee residence. Work will: • Remove, label, and store the existing historic sashes in the Pump House; • Carefully remove the existing interior window stops and trim and set aside for reuse; • Install twenty-two (22) new double pane, clear yellow pine sashes (identical in wood, dimension, and style to the originals) with antique brass hardware; • Utilize tempered safety glass where required by law; • Paint to match existing interior and exterior; and • Repair and stabilize the exterior sills as needed and repaint the exterior of the house.

Notice of Exemption

Exempt Status
Categorical Exemption
Type, Section or Code
15301, 15331
Reasons for Exemption
Project consists of the repair, maintenance and minor alteration of existing public facilities and structures involving negligible or no expansion of use beyond current levels and projects limited to the maintenance, repair, stabilization, rehabilitation , preservation, and conservation of historical resources, in a manner consistent with the Secretary of the Interior's Standards for Treatment of Historic Properties with Guidelines for Preserving, Rehabilitating, Restoring, and Reconstructing Historic Buildings (1995), Weeks and Grimmer.
